PlayStation Plus Report Reveals Addition of AAA Horror Game for October 2025

According to a post on Dealabs, *Alan Wake 2* is expected to be a free PlayStation Plus game in October 2025. It’s believed to be the biggest of three games added to the service next month, and if the information is accurate-Dealabs is usually reliable-PS Plus members should be able to download it from October 7th to November 4th.

Major New Alien vs. Predator Movie Theory Just Got Shot Down (For Now)

In a recent interview with *Empire*, creator Noah Hawley dashed fans’ hopes for a crossover between *Predator* and *Alien*. He confirmed that no Xenomorphs will appear in the movie, but emphasized this actually makes the story stronger. Hawley explained they didn’t want to simply combine the two franchises for the sake of it, and that the inclusion of the Weyland-Yutani corporation is driven by genuine narrative reasons.
